This private 3-day scenic tour runs across New Zealand’s South Island, beginning in Queenstown in the Otago Region and finishing in Christchurch on the east coast. Designed for travelers who value views over schedules, it threads alpine passes, glacial valleys, rainforest, and clear mountain lakes into a single route. The trip highlights include Lake Wanaka, the Blue Pools, Franz Josef Glacier, Haast Pass and the cross-island ride over Arthur’s Pass. Departure and meeting point: Queenstown.
Day one moves fast with a purposeful early start out of Queenstown toward Wanaka. Stops at Lake Wanaka offer wide-water perspectives and photo-friendly shorelines; an optional detour to the Blue Pools rewards with short, easy walking and hymn-like streams tumbling through native beech forest. As the van drops toward the West Coast the landscape flips from schist mountains to dense temperate rainforest and long, glacial-fed rivers.
Franz Josef sits at the heart of day two: a flexible, choose-your-own-adventure day where guests can book a scenic helicopter flight to see ice-carved crevasses, join a guided glacier walk, soak in hot pools, or opt for quiet rainforest trails. Franz Josef Glacier is one of the few temperate glaciers that descends from high peaks into lowland forest, which creates dramatic contrasts in light, texture, and vegetation that photographers and naturalists prize.
On day three the drive climbs Haast Pass, passing waterfalls and alpine viewpoints before cutting across the Southern Alps via Arthur’s Pass. Optional stops include Castle Hill’s sculpted rock outcrops and short riverside walks that break the long-haul drive to Christchurch.
